The AirTAC SDA32X40B is a double-acting single-rod compact cylinder engineered to deliver 402.1 N of push force and 345.6 N of pull force at 0.5 MPa. Its riveted assembly minimizes axial mounting depth, making it ideal for machinery where space is tight. Because this SKU includes the B option, the 12 mm piston rod terminates in a male M10x1.25 thread for straightforward load coupling.
This unit relies on a fixed NBR bumper at each end to decelerate the stroke, meaning there is no field-adjustable air cushion. Operating speeds span 30-500 mm/s. Note that this specific configuration lacks a piston magnet, so it cannot directly host AirTAC reed or electronic switches without changing to an S-suffix variant.
| Model | AirTAC SDA32X40B Compact Cylinder | 32mm Bore |
|---|---|
| Series | SDA compact (thin) cylinder |
| Bore size | Ø32 mm |
| Stroke | 40 mm |
| Acting type | Double acting |
| Port size | PT1/8 |
| Rod end thread | M6×1.0 female / M10×1.25 male (B) |
| Fluid | Air (filtered by 40µm element) |
|---|---|
| Operating pressure | 0.15 – 1.0 MPa |
| Proof pressure | 1.5 MPa |
| Temperature | -20 to +70 °C |
| Speed range | 30 – 500 mm/s |
| Cushion | Fixed NBR bumper (both ends) |
| Max standard stroke | Up to 120 mm |
Specifications follow the official AirTAC SDA compact-cylinder datasheet. Confirm against the product label before installation. Port thread: PT (standard). Rod: female thread (blank) / male thread (B).
| Pressure | Push force | Pull force |
|---|---|---|
| 0.5 MPa | 402 N | 346 N |
| 0.7 MPa | 563 N | — |
| Max (@1.0 MPa) | 82 kgf | |
Actual usable force is lower than theoretical due to friction and back-pressure. Size with a safety margin.
| SDA | Compact (thin) double-acting cylinder series. |
|---|---|
| 32 | Bore size in mm. |
| ×40 | Stroke length in mm. |
| S | Built-in magnet for magnetic-switch position sensing (omit = no magnet). |
| B | Male-thread piston rod (omit = female-thread rod). |
Thread: PT standard. Related SDA-family variants: SSA (single-acting push), STA (single-acting pull), SDAD (double rod), SDAJ (adjustable stroke), SDAT (duplex), SDAW (duplex-end).

When sizing this 32 mm bore actuator, consider stepping down to the SDA25, which provides 245.4 N of push at 0.5 MPa, or moving up to the SDA40, which yields 628.3 N at the same pressure. For the SDA32X40B, the safe working load is approximately 241 N (about 60% of the 402.1 N figure), translating to a vertical lift capacity of roughly 20.5 kg with a 2:1 safety margin. Ensure your ordering essentials cover the 40 mm stroke, PT1/8 port, and the male M10x1.25 rod end. If the application requires holding a load during air loss or valve centering, be aware the piston will drift; the fixed bumper only decelerates near the stroke end and acts as neither a lock nor a brake. An external rod lock or pilot-operated check valve is required for secure positioning.
